GPS watch help

Morning all Can I have a recommendation for a GPS watch under ??100. I don't need bells and whistles, just how far I've run and pace. I'm training for marathons now, so I need to get up to 22 miles or so without guessing!! Cheers

Comments

  • Garmins are good quality and reliable. The software for uploading your runs to the Garmin website is great, shows you all the data. You can get the entry level one for around that price. Or if you have a smart phone download the Nike plus app for free, its not as reliable as the garmin but still good for free. May be an idea to check out second hand prices on eBay. The 410 has just been reduced by amazon to ??170 I paid ??250 for mine a year ago, you could get a good 2nd hand one for maybe ??70-100 or possibly the 610 if you can stretch your budget a bit.

  • I run with a cheapo digital watch and currently use WalkJogRun to record my runs.  I love it but get sick of updating manually so I am thinking of buying a Forerunner F10.  With regard to downloading stats to the Garmin Connect site, can anyone out there tell me if the F10 is compatible with a Nexus 7 (which doesn't have a standard USB port)?  Replies in words of one syllable please, cos I am not a techie!

    I don't have that particular model but think so.

    If you get an app off the Play Store called "Uploader for Garmin" then that will allow you to connect your Garmin to the tablet and upload to Garmin Connect. If the tablet has a micro usb instead of a standard usb then you'll need an adapter, but they're pennies to buy: http://www.amazon.co.uk/female-Micro-male-Connector-Adapter/dp/B005GI5H22/ref=sr_1_2?ie=UTF8&qid=1362339525&sr=8-2
